The structure theorem states that it is possible to write any computer program using only ________ basic control structures

Respuesta :

s157778
s157778 s157778
  • 02-08-2022

Answer:

three

Explanation:

Structured programming is based on three control structures: sequence, selection, and repetition. The structure theorem states that any program can be written using only three control structures.
